The global economy is undergoing a significant transformation as it pivots towards green energy, marking a crucial moment in the fight against climate change. According to the results published in the material, with investments in clean energy expected to soar to $22 trillion, the financial dynamics of the energy sector are set to change dramatically.

Clean Energy Investments Surpass Fossil Fuels

Recent reports indicate that the allocation for clean energy investments will more than double that of fossil fuels, which stands at $11 trillion. This shift is not merely a trend but a fundamental change in how energy markets operate, driven by both environmental concerns and economic incentives.

Surging Demand for Sustainable Energy Solutions

As countries and corporations commit to reducing carbon emissions, the demand for sustainable energy solutions is surging. Investors are increasingly recognizing the potential for growth in renewable energy sectors, which are becoming more competitive and technologically advanced. This transition presents both opportunities and challenges for traditional energy producers, who must adapt to a rapidly evolving market landscape.

Broader Commitment to Sustainability

The implications of this shift extend beyond just financial metrics; they signal a broader commitment to sustainability that could redefine global energy policies and investment strategies in the coming decades.
